Blackpool South station is designed with simplicity in mind, ensuring ease of use for travelers. Though it lacks a traditional ticket office and on-site ticket machines, it caters to accessibility needs with step-free access throughout, making it mobility scooter friendly. Boarding ramps are available for train access, providing a seamless experience for mobility-impaired passengers. Despite the absence of waiting rooms or refreshment options, passengers can find peace of mind knowing there are seating areas and a clear layout to navigate with ease.
Connecting Blackpool South station to wider routes, there are several transport links available. For those needing rail replacement services, you can find pick-up and drop-off points at the station entrance on Waterloo Road. Taxis can be arranged through online services like cab4you, ensuring smooth transitions between train and road journeys. While there’s a bus service, it's worth noting that the nearest tram stop is about a mile away. When travelling through Whitland, you'll find essential facilities to enhance your journey. While there is no staffed ticket office, you can conveniently purchase and collect your tickets from accessible machines anytime. The station is equipped with step-free access, ensuring hassle-free movement, especially if you're navigating with heavy luggage or require special assistance. If you need immediate support, a helpful helpline is at your service, making travel planning smoother.
Although waiting rooms and refreshment facilities are absent, seating is provided for your comfort as you await your train. For passengers with bicycles, Whitland offers storage options with six spaces available, although further cycling amenities like hiring services are not present here. If nature calls, unfortunately, there are no public toilets available on-site, advising travellers to plan accordingly.
Transport connections from Whitland are facilitated chiefly by local buses, with a rail replacement bus stop conveniently located near the station on Station Road.
